27 Feb Home Affairs: Decryption Proposal Won’t Undermine Legitimate Encryption
Australia’s Department of Home Affairs secretary Michael Pezzullo recently defended the government’s new proposal on communications decryption, saying that it will not undermine legitimate encryption.
When asked for specifics by Australian Greens Senator Jordon Steele-John, Pezzullo insisted that the legislation is not a backdoor, and it only seeks to balance societal needs for encryption. He further explained that it only needs to be made available for users who do not plan to misuse it.
The secretary further said that they still prefer to have a dialogue and consultation with industry, and that the legislation will only be introduced if new Minister for Home Affairs Peter Dutton sees it to be necessary.
